Minor Resolved · 8 months ago · lasted about 3 hours
Degraded Performance on the GitLab Customer Portal
The Customers Portal (customers.gitlab.com) is experiencing intermittent 503 errors due to a partial outage on a 3rd-party API. Details in https://gitlab.com/gitlab-com/gl-infra/production/-/issues/7550.
